Meet the mascots

Advertisement

Everyone loves and remembers a good mascot. Sports teams, top companies and lots of other organisations know that a cute mascot promotes their image and makes people notice them. The first Olympic mascot, a cartoon version of a skier, appeared at the 1968 Winter Olympics, and the idea quickly caught on. The first official mascot of the Summer Olympics was a red jaguar and made its appearance at the 1968 Summer Games in Mexico City. But it wasn't given a name. The Olympic mascot really became popular with the appearance of Misha, a bear cub, at the 1980 Olympics in Moscow. Misha was cute and cuddly and he set the standard for the Olympic mascots that were to follow him.
